COTA Qualifying: Secrets to a Winning Qualifying Run

The Circuit of the Americas (COTA) presents a unique challenge for drivers, a thrilling blend of high-speed straights and demanding corners. Mastering COTA's complexities is crucial for securing a prime grid position in qualifying. This article delves into the secrets to achieving a winning qualifying run at this iconic track.

Understanding the COTA Track Layout

Before diving into qualifying strategies, understanding the track's characteristics is paramount. COTA is known for its:

  • High-Speed Straights: These require maximum aerodynamic efficiency and engine power to maintain speed and overtake rivals. Optimal car setup for these sections is crucial.
  • Technical Corners: COTA features a variety of corners, from slow hairpins to fast sweeping turns. Precise braking points, smooth steering inputs, and proper car balance are essential for navigating these successfully. This requires a deft touch and careful analysis of the track's cambers and elevation changes.
  • Elevation Changes: The track's significant elevation changes impact car dynamics and require drivers to adapt their driving style accordingly. Understanding the effects of these changes is key to consistent lap times.

Analyzing Sector Times: Key to Improvement

COTA's lap is often broken down into three sectors. Analyzing the individual sector times provides invaluable insight into areas for improvement. A detailed analysis should include:

  • Sector 1: Focus on maximizing speed through the high-speed esses and the long straight.
  • Sector 2: Optimize the car's balance for the technical corners, focusing on smooth transitions and minimal time loss in the slower sections.
  • Sector 3: Maintain speed through the final turns, aiming for a strong exit onto the main straight for the final push to the finish line.

Qualifying Strategies: Mastering the Art of Speed

Securing a pole position at COTA requires a multi-faceted approach:

1. Optimal Car Setup: The Foundation of Speed

Your car's setup is the cornerstone of a successful qualifying run. A perfectly balanced car is critical to managing the varied demands of the track. This means finding the optimal balance between:

  • Aerodynamics: Maximizing downforce for cornering speed while minimizing drag on the straights is a delicate act.
  • Suspension: Fine-tuning suspension settings to perfectly handle the track's bumps and elevation changes is crucial.
  • Tire Pressure: Choosing the right tire pressure will maximize grip and minimize wear during the crucial qualifying laps.

2. Tire Management: A Race Against the Clock

Tire management is critical. The tires degrade during a qualifying session, influencing the car's handling, speed, and overall performance. Therefore, strategic tire choices and driving techniques that minimize wear are critical.

3. Track Conditions: Adapting to the Environment

Track conditions, including temperature and humidity, significantly impact car performance and tire behavior. Drivers must adapt their driving style and car setup to these changes.

4. Towing and Slipstreaming: The Advantage of Precision

Utilizing the slipstream of another car can provide a significant speed boost on the long straights, but requires precise timing and execution. Mastering this technique is crucial.

5. Data Analysis: Refining Performance

Analyzing telemetry data from previous practice sessions is essential to understanding car performance and identifying areas for improvement. This will help anticipate issues and fine-tune the setup for qualifying.
